Introduction to Thermal Blenders

Thermal blenders, also known as cooking blenders or thermoblenders, are a type of blender that can heat and cook ingredients while blending them. These blenders use a combination of heat, speed, and friction to cook a variety of dishes, from soups and sauces to desserts and even main courses. Thermal blenders are designed to provide a convenient and efficient way to prepare meals, allowing users to chop, blend, and cook ingredients in a single device.

How Thermal Blenders Work

Thermal blenders work by using a heating element, typically located in the base of the blender, to warm up the ingredients. The heating element can be electric or thermoelectric, and it is designed to heat the ingredients to a specific temperature. The blender’s motor then uses a combination of speed and friction to blend the ingredients, creating a smooth and consistent texture. Some thermal blenders also come with additional features, such as temperature control, timers, and automatic shut-off, to make cooking easier and safer.

What is a thermal blender and how does it work?

A thermal blender is a type of blender that is designed to not only blend and mix ingredients but also to cook them. This is achieved through the use of a heating element, such as a thermoblock or a heating coil, which is built into the blender. The heating element is typically located at the bottom of the blender jar and is controlled by a thermostat or a microprocessor. This allows the blender to heat the ingredients to a precise temperature, making it possible to cook a wide range of dishes, from soups and sauces to desserts and even main courses.

The thermal blender works by using a combination of heat and friction to cook the ingredients. The blades of the blender are designed to rotate at high speed, creating a vortex that draws the ingredients down towards the heating element. As the ingredients come into contact with the heating element, they are heated to the desired temperature. The thermostat or microprocessor controls the temperature of the heating element, ensuring that the ingredients are cooked evenly and safely. This makes it possible to cook a wide range of dishes with ease and precision, from delicate sauces to hearty soups and stews.

How do I choose the right thermal blender for my needs?

Choosing the right thermal blender for your needs depends on several factors, including the type of cooking you plan to do, the size of the blender, and the features you require. If you plan to cook large quantities of food, you will need a blender with a large capacity, such as 2 liters or more. If you plan to cook delicate sauces or desserts, you will need a blender with a high degree of precision and control, such as a blender with a thermostat or microprocessor.

When choosing a thermal blender, you should also consider the features that are important to you, such as a timer, a temperature control, or a non-stick coating. Some thermal blenders also come with additional features, such as a built-in scale or a recipe book. You should also consider the brand and model of the blender, as well as the warranty and customer support offered by the manufacturer. Are thermal blenders safe to use?

Yes, thermal blenders are safe to use, as long as you follow the manufacturer’s instructions and take certain precautions. Thermal blenders are designed with safety features, such as a thermostat or microprocessor, which controls the temperature of the heating element and prevents it from overheating. They are also designed with a secure lid, which prevents hot ingredients from splashing out of the blender.

However, as with any electrical appliance, there are certain precautions you should take when using a thermal blender. You should always read the manufacturer’s instructions carefully and follow them closely. You should also ensure that the blender is placed on a stable and heat-resistant surface, and that it is kept out of reach of children and pets. You should also be careful when handling hot ingredients and avoid touching the heating element or the blades, as they can cause burns.
